Award winning jazz vocalist and songwriter, Sharon Schmidt started singing professionally at the age of 18 where she performed at the Nightingale Ballroom in Waukesha, Wisconsin.
She is influenced by Peggy Lee, Ella Fitzgerald, Rosemary Clooney, Billie Holiday, Diana Krall, Keely Smith and the tunes of Nat King Cole.
After raising her family, she has returned to her singing career with various local bands in the Milwaukee and Waukesha area.
You may have heard Sharon at the former Red Mill, the Midway Hotel, Piano Blu, and The Golden Mast. She has also been a guest artist with the All Star Superband.
Currently, Sharon can be heard at Neighbor's Bistro in Waukesha , The Golden Mast on Okauchee Lake, The Cornerstone Restaurant in Genessee Depot and the 2006 Sum merfest music festival.
Sharon has just completed her long awaited first CD called "Dancing In The Kitchen" a jazz collaboration packed with the strong musicianship of Sam Steffke on keyboard, Tom McGirr on bass, Tim Bell on sax Tom Utschig on drums. The CD has just been released.
